Dare to Dance

Dare to Dance by P. Diane Truswell, published by Xlibris Corporation LLC in November 2007, is a poignant exploration of personal transformation and family dynamics. This 208-page book follows the journey of Karen, an ordinary woman navigating the profound grief and bitterness following her husband’s sudden death. As she grapples with the complexities of her 21-year marriage, Karen is faced with unexpected revelations that challenge her understanding of her identity and life choices.
Readers will find a narrative that delves into the intertwined experiences of Karen and her family as they each seek their own truths amidst the turmoil. The story addresses themes of family life, marriage, and the impact of loss, offering insights into the emotional landscape of relationships. Dare to Dance presents a thoughtful examination of how individuals confront their realities and the connections that bind them, making it a reflective read for those interested in family and relationships.
Official synopsis Publisher
Dare To Dance is the story of Karen, an ordinary woman with two adult children, who finds herself confronted by unexpected life twists and the obstacles that follow.
The sudden death of her husband plummets Karen into a well of grief and bitterness. After 21 years of marriage, her bereavement is complicated by a shocking revelation that floods her mind with unanswerable questions. Who was she in that marriage, and who is she now? Has her whole life been an elaborate lie?
Dare To Dance demonstrates the separate but connected ways a woman and her family find their own truths.
